I am trying to get powerpoints from my schools online course tools onto my galaxy note 10.1. I see there is a program to make powerpoints on but when I click the link to download the powerpoints nothing happens. How can you download documents such as these to a galaxy note 10.1?
 
Download them via a browser. Use a file explorer app (plenty in the Play Store if you don't have one) to copy the files from your download folder to wherever you'd like to keep them, then view them using your powerpoint viewer.

You don't need a special app to download powerpoints.

The other option would be to download them to a PC, use powerpoint on the PC to convert them to PDF, then copy the PDFs to the tablet. If you find that your powerpoint viewer isn't good enough, this would be another way of doing it.

You might also try speaking to your schools IT support. I had to contact mine as no files would download from my schools website because the links were formatted in a strange way and they have since changed it in upgrades to our system.

You could also try downloading a different web browser such as google chrome or firefox from the google play store as these may fetch the files in a different way.
